Mining the Strait of Hormuz, which Iran is now attempting to do, is the ultimate trump card.<\/p>\n<p>Using mines to shut down this narrow shipping lane \u2014 which contributes about 20% of the world\u2019s oil supply, not to mention natural gas and fertilizer \u2014 could result in a crippled global economy, mass casualties and a situation in which the president can no longer save face while cutting and running.<\/p>\n<p>As retired U.S. Navy Adm. <a class=\"link\" href=\"https:\/\/economictimes.indiatimes.com\/news\/international\/world-news\/middle-east-war-iran-can-turn-the-persian-gulf-into-a-minefield-israel-conflict-strait-of-hormuz-oil-supply-disruption\/articleshow\/129071041.cms?from=mdr\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">James Stavridis writes<\/a>, \u201cIran has been planning a Strait of Hormuz closure operation for decades and probably has more than 5,000 mines; just one hit can severely damage a thin-skinned tanker.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Yes, once laid, minefields can be cleared. But <a class=\"link\" href=\"https:\/\/x.com\/stavridisj\/status\/2031709034521190858\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">Stavridis predicts<\/a> it would take \u201cweeks, if not a month or two\u201d to clear thousands of mines. He warns: \u201cThe global economy needs to be prepared for a month or two shutdown.\u201d (Complicating matters is the fact that <a class=\"link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.cnn.com\/world\/live-news\/iran-war-us-israel-trump-03-10-26#cmmlbxtay00003b6wuxr2s40c\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">our dedicated minesweepers were recently decommissioned<\/a>.)<\/p>\n<p>The Iranians are not idiots.
